    Astrid Kirchherr in front of the Cavern Club in Liverpool, 1964.
    Astrid Kirchherr was a German photographer and artist known for her association with the Beatles and her photographs of the band's original members.
    The Beatles' first performance at the Cavern Club was on 9 February 1961, featuring John Lennon, Paul McCartney, George Harrison, Stuart Sutcliffe, and Pete Best on drums.
    The Beatles soon established themselves as the Cavern Club's signature act.
    It became the place where their musical identity was forged, and many of their fans maintain that the band was at its best during those lunchtime gigs, learning stagecraft through exchanges with the audience only inches away.
    The band was always nostalgic about the Cavern.
